Why it stands out
The 2016 Nissan Frontier is well-regarded for its powerful V6 engine, delivering a robust 261 horsepower and 281 lb-ft of torque, making it a solid choice for those needing performance and towing capability. Owners appreciate its reliability and comfort, especially with its practical features like rear cameras and Bluetooth integration. However, the Frontier is built on a 12-year-old platform, which has led to some criticisms regarding its efficiency and outdated technology when compared to more modern competitors. Despite these shortcomings, it remains an appealing option for buyers looking for a cost-effective midsize truck that offers decent utility and comfort at a lower price point.

2016 Nissan Frontier Trims
| Trim type | MSRP |
|---|---|
| SV V6 King Cab | $24,440 |
| Desert Runner Crew Cab | $26,340 |
| S Crew Cab | $23,500 |
| SV V6 King Cab 4WD | $27,140 |
| PRO-4X Crew Cab 4WD | $32,340 |
| S King Cab | $18,290 |
| SV Crew Cab | $25,460 |
| SV Crew Cab 4WD | $28,460 |
